Up until recently (18-30 months ago) NSA employees were only allowed to identify themselves as employees of DoD. It was common knowledge, that unspecific references to Fort Meade meant NSA; and if you saw a P.O. from Procurement Office, Fort Meade, it meant the NSA was buying it.
Nothing has really changed. During orientation, you are told to keep your NSA affiliation low key. But you are not ordered to. This was part of the No Such Agency stuff, trying not to draw attention to yourself or the Agency, and to avoid questions from the curious. Perhaps the most important reason for keeping it low key though, was to preserve your career options. But for disciplines such as crypto, the choices are quite limited so broadcasting you are NSA does not matter much.
